No sound for email notifications on iPhone 15 Pro after iOS 18.4 update

After the 18.4 update, I no longer hear sounds when I get an email. Notifications appear on screen, but no sound.

Was just able to resolve this issue on my iPhone 15 Pro running ios 18.4. Try this:

Delete and Reinstall the Mail App

  1. Tap and hold the Mail app icon from your Home screen to reveal a Delete App option. Tap that to remove the app, then restart your iPhone.
  2. After your iPhone starts up again, download Mail from the App Store.
  3. You may also need to return to the Passwords & Accounts settings to turn Mail on for each of your email accounts again.
  4. Go to Notifications and check to see that “Allow Notifications” is turned ON for all eMail accounts.
  5. For safety make sure iCloud Backup is still active as well (for some reason it was turned off after updating to the latest ios a few days ago and I was unaware of this issue).

Temporary Solution: Restore VIP Notifications in the Mail App on iPhone (iOS 18.4.1)




Step 1 – Temporarily disable Mail for all accounts:


1. Go to Settings > Mail > Accounts


2. Select each account (iCloud, Gmail, Outlook, etc.)


3. Toggle off the Mail option for all accounts



Step 2 – Delete the Mail app:


1. Press and hold the Mail app icon on the home screen


2. Select “Remove App” and confirm



Step 3 – Reinstall the Mail app:


1. Open App Store


2. Search for “Apple Mail”


3. Download and reinstall the app



Step 4 – Re-enable Mail for your accounts:


1. Go back to Settings > Mail > Accounts


2. Select each account and toggle Mail back on



Step 5 – Adjust VIP notification sound:


1. Go to Settings > Notifications > Mail > VIP


2. Choose a different sound (e.g., “Crystal”)


3. Wait a few seconds, then switch back to your preferred sound



Done!


VIP notifications with sound should now work as expected again, including push delivery for iCloud Mail.

I had the same issue for more than one month, I've read Jtropic's post and tried removing Apple mail app from iPhone 16 pro once and reinstalled it. Then mail notification came again! In addition, my wife's iPhone 16e has also the same issues, and re-installing mail app in the same way made her mail alerts to come back too.

I guess that after iOS updates ,there're some settings information was untouched by operations via GUI and it did harm to the notification functions.
